Dynatrace Pricing: A Closer Look

When budgeting for a new cloud security software, checking out Dynatrace's price tag is key. The good news is they make it simple with subscription-based costs.

Now every company is different, so exact rates depend on things like your number of devices and features needed. But generally, here's what you can expect to dish out each month with Dynatrace:

  • Application Monitoring - Starting at around $11 per host. Not too shabby to have apps on lock!

  • Infrastructure Monitoring - Usually looking at $69 per lone server. Well worth it for such control.

  • Digital Experience Monitoring - Prices begin at 15 cents per session for synth tests. Keep tabs on users affordably.

  • Full-Stack Monitoring - Often bundled, but around $69 per device on average. One price fits your whole environment.

Of course, to make sure you get the perfect Dynatrace package, always check their site or talk pricing direct with a rep. No two networks are identical, so get the quote fit for yours. Overall though, you're getting a lotta value for a reasonable monthly cost.

 FAQs about Dynatrace


What is the use of Dynatrace?

Dynatrace is primarily used for application performance monitoring (APM). It helps businesses understand how their applications are performing, identify performance bottlenecks, and troubleshoot issues. Additionally, it offers features for cloud security, digital experience monitoring, and artificial intelligence-driven insights.

Is Dynatrace a good tool?

Dynatrace is considered a powerful and effective tool for APM and increasingly for cloud security. Its ability to automatically detect anomalies and provide in-depth performance data makes it a valuable asset for many organizations. However, the suitability of Dynatrace depends on specific needs, budget, and the complexity of your IT environment.
Is Dynatrace free or paid?

Dynatrace is a paid software. They offer different pricing plans based on the size of your environment and the features you require.

What is the difference between Dynatrace and Splunk?

While both Dynatrace and Splunk are powerful data platforms, they serve different primary purposes. Dynatrace excels in application performance monitoring, providing deep insights into application behavior. Splunk is a broader platform for data indexing, searching, and analysis, often used for IT operations, security, and business intelligence.
Is Dynatrace real-time monitoring?

Yes, Dynatrace offers real-time monitoring of application performance and infrastructure metrics. This enables you to identify and address issues promptly.

Is Dynatrace an analytics tool?

Yes, Dynatrace incorporates advanced analytics capabilities. It uses AI and machine learning to analyze vast amounts of data, providing actionable insights into application performance and potential problems.

What type of software is Dynatrace?

Dynatrace is primarily classified as application performance monitoring (APM) software. However, due to its expanding feature set, it can also be considered a digital experience monitoring (DEM) and cloud security tool.

Is Dynatrace an API?

No, Dynatrace is not an API itself. However, it provides APIs that allow you to integrate with other tools and systems, enabling automation and data exchange.

What is the difference between Dynatrace and Grafana?

Dynatrace is a comprehensive APM and cloud security platform that collects, analyzes, and visualizes data. Grafana is primarily an open-source visualization and monitoring tool that can be used to display data from various sources, including Dynatrace. Grafana excels in creating custom dashboards and visualizations, while Dynatrace focuses on deep performance insights and automation.
